Output 373302134d93c57c0e8c4dd8db68a74737fded2d5d7a2473c01b8b91ddb235b9:6

value
596665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9034f2d55ae2a170be5b77fe85f8d4eba6b0d9 OP_EQUAL
address
3EWFH4o69eUL168KmEm6fCJTdG7Rn3tDX8
transaction
373302134d93c57c0e8c4dd8db68a74737fded2d5d7a2473c01b8b91ddb235b9
spent
true